Common use of Permitted Delays Clause in Contracts

Permitted Delays. Whenever performance is required of any party hereunder, such party shall use all due diligence and take all necessary measures in good faith to perform; provided, however, that if completion of performance shall be delayed at any time by reason of acts of God, war, civil commotion, riots, strikes, picketing, or other labor disputes, unavailability of labor or materials, inability to obtain the required permits, or damage to work in progress by reason of fire or other casualty or similar causes beyond the reasonable control of a party (other than financial reasons), then the time for performance as herein specified shall be appropriately extended by the time of the delay actually caused by such circumstances. If (i) there should arise any permitted delay for which the Company or the Local Government Bodies are entitled to delay performance under this Agreement and (ii) the Company or the Local Government Bodies anticipate that such permitted delay will cause a delay in their performance under this Agreement, then the Company or the Local Government Bodies, as the case may be, agree to provide written notice to the other parties of this Agreement of the nature and the anticipated length of such delay.
